A 57-year-old cyclist is in stable but serious condition today after receiving injuries to his head and face Sunday during a collision with a motor vehicle, according to the Maricopa Police Department.

Around 7 p.m., Maricopa police and fire personnel responded to West Honeycutt Road east of White and Parker Road.

The 39-year-old male driver said he was travelling east on West Honeycutt Road when the collision occurred.

Fire personnel examined the 57-year-old male bicyclist at the scene and had him taken by ambulance to Maricopa Medical Center in Phoenix.

No charges have been filed at this time and the collision is under investigation.
